The Weyburn Cobra Wrestling Club are gearing up for their season. In order to get things going, though, they require wrestlers.

Clark Gawryliuk from the club said they will be holding registrations Monday evening, from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. at the Weyburn Credit Union Community Room. The club has age ranges from children born in 2000, to kids born in 2011. The Freshie and Pee Wee programs (2006-2011) practice on Tuesdays and Thursdays from 6:00 p.m. to 7:15 p.m. at the Soo Line Daycare Gym. The Bantam to Juvenile Athletes, born from 2000-2005, practice Tuesdays and Thursdays from 7:30 p.m. to 9:00 p.m., and on Wednesdays from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m.

Gawryliuk said the club has had a number of successes in the past and has quite a few athletes who will more than likely compete at the provincial and national level once again.

The club is also expecting to have a good showing at their annual home tournament. The meet will be held on December 2nd, at Weyburn Comprehensive School, and will feature up to 150 athletes from across the province.
